  • How do i download itunes to a different folder

    My work laptop requires me to download personal software to a localapps folder within the C program files area. iTunes downloads automatically to a predetermined locatipn on the C drive and does not offer a location choice. How can I get passed this problem?

    You do not.
    iTunes like all programs is installed and only runs on the main drive (C) of the computer.
    You can move the media to another drive.
    Close iTunes.
    Move the ENTIRE iTunes folder from the default location to the desired location.
    While holding the SHIFT key, launch iTunes.
    When prompted to create a new library or locate existing, choose the option to locate existing.
    Point iTunes to the new location.
    Then go to Edit > Preferences > Advanced and change the location of the iTunes library there.

  • How do I move itunes library from my ipad back to my itunes library in my windows computer ?

    How do I move itunes library from my ipad back to my itunes library in my windows computer ? All the songs got transfered by mistake from my windows itunes library to my ipad. All i had wanted to do was to move a select # of songs newly purchased from my ipad to my ipod but I got mixed up. Before i knew it all teh library had been moved to my ipad?  HELP!

    You don't have to move the songs back into iTunes if you don't want to, the songs are still in iTunes on your computer - you just copied a version of the songs onto the iPad from iTunes.
    If you want to remove them from the device itself, just swipe across the song while you are in song list mode in the music app and a red delete button will pop up. You can also tap and hold down on a playlist or a album icon and the X to delete will pop up. It will not work for Genius playlists.
    You can also connect the iPad to the computer, launch iTunes, select the iPad on the left side, click on the Music Tab on the right, uncheck all of the music that you want to remove, click on Apply in the lower right corner of iTunes, and that will remove the songs from the iPad.

  • C drive is full how do I move iTunes to d drive?

    How do I move iTunes from one drive to another? My c drive is full I changed my preferences to d, yet I still can not back up my iPhone or iPad. I think I need to move iTunes I am just not sure if I should uninstall from c and reinstall to d?  Any suggestions or help.
    Thank you
    Sue

    Copy the entire iTunes folder from your music folder to D:\iTunes.
    Click the icon to start iTunes and immediately press and hold down the shift key. Keep holding until asked to choose or create a library.
    Click Choose and navigate to the file D:\iTunes\iTunes Library.itl
    Check the library is working properly.
    Use the option File > Library > Organize Library > Consolidate Files to import any stay files to the new library folder.
    Delete the old iTunes folder on the C: drive.
    Ideally you will also backup this library to another drive.
